State Route 27 reopens after semi rollover spills grain, diesel
A semitruck rolled over on state Route 27 around 9:30 a.m. Sunday 2 miles south of Fairfield, spilling grain and diesel and leading to the road being completely blocked off, according to a Washington State Patrol news release.
